Latest Information on Fiat Stilo
The Stilo was a small family car produced between 2001 and 2010. Three versions constituted the range: a 3-door hatchback, 5-door hatchback and station wagon. The hatchbacks were the successor to the Fiat Bravo/Brava range. The 3-door was the more sportier looking car and was even available in an Abarth trim. The 5-door was more family-oriented, offering better accessibility and legroom. The cabins also had a sensible layout. Good visibility from the driver’s seat was also a plus due to the high driving position in the Stilo. However, sales for the Stilo never really took off even after the use of expensive and extensive advertising campaigns that made use of renowned F1 drivers.
